Dockerhub回购的正确上传URL是什么
我正在按照指示做这件事 我已到达步骤3,在VS代码中,我正在执行Dockerhub回购的正确上传URL是什么,docker,dockerhub,azure-iot-edge,microsoft-custom-vision,Docker,Dockerhub,Azure Iot Edge,Microsoft Custom Vision,我正在按照指示做这件事 我已到达步骤3,在VS代码中,我正在执行构建并推送到物联网边缘解决方案,这将触发以下命令: docker build --rm -f "/Users/myname/Dropbox/Dev/azure/custom-vision/Custom-vision-service-iot-edge-raspberry-pi/modules/CameraCapture/arm32v7.Dockerfile" -t registry.hub.docker.com/v1/reposit
构建并推送到物联网边缘解决方案
,这将触发以下命令:
docker build --rm -f "/Users/myname/Dropbox/Dev/azure/custom-vision/Custom-vision-service-iot-edge-raspberry-pi/modules/CameraCapture/arm32v7.Dockerfile" -t registry.hub.docker.com/v1/repositories/myname/iot-hub-1/cameracapture:0.2.7-arm32v7 "/Users/myname/Dropbox/Dev/azure/custom-vision/Custom-vision-service-iot-edge-raspberry-pi/modules/CameraCapture"
&& docker push registry.hub.docker.com/v1/repositories/myname/iot-hub-1/cameracapture:0.2.7-arm32v7
&& docker build --rm -f "/Users/myname/Dropbox/Dev/azure/custom-vision/Custom-vision-service-iot-edge-raspberry-pi/modules/ImageClassifierService/arm32v7.Dockerfile" -t registry.hub.docker.com/v1/repositories/myname/iot-hub-1/imageclassifierservice:0.2.4-arm32v7 "/Users/myname/Dropbox/Dev/azure/custom-vision/Custom-vision-service-iot-edge-raspberry-pi/modules/ImageClassifierService"
&& docker push registry.hub.docker.com/v1/repositories/myname/iot-hub-1/imageclassifierservice:0.2.4-arm32v7
404失败-找不到页面
我还尝试使用cloud.docker.com/repository/registry-1.docker.io/myname/iot-hub-1
,但这给了我一个不同的错误:
无效参数
“cloud.docker.com/repository/docker/myname/iot-hub-1:latest/cameracapture:0.2.7-arm32v7”
对于“-t,--tag”标志:引用格式无效
任何人都可以帮助我找到正确的URL路径,或者帮助我完成将容器上载到docker hub存储库所需的其他步骤吗?使用以下方法:
docker push <hub-user>/<repo-name>:<tag>
您需要先登录
docker
。然后构建镜像dockerbuild-t/:
,然后只需按dockerpush/:
。您不需要为Docker Hub指定任何特定的URL。我找不到Docker Hub的正确URL,但Azure容器注册表能够解决我的问题
URL的详细信息如下:可能重复的如果您想将图像推送到Docker Hub,请尝试将module.json中的
图像->存储库更新到您的Docker Hub用户名/repo名称
docker push username/reponame:latest